Over the last year our department received large corporate donations from about 20 companies. Cisco donated high-speed network equipment; Microsoft provided department-wide licenses to a wide variety of their software, plus gave several individual cash and equipment grants; Alias/Wavefront provide department-wide licenses for their Maya graphics software; and Pixar provided a large number of licenses for Renderman. Additional gifts to the Computer Sciences Department include graduate fellowships, undergraduate scholarships, research/instructional equipment, faculty development grants, and unrestricted cash. The research and instructional equipment, and the faculty and student support, provided by these corporations constitute a major asset of our department.
Relationships between the department and these companies include many joint research activities, as well as other interactions of mutual interest.
